a story usually has one main theme, but it may also have other themes. to determine the story’s theme or themes:
note the setting of the story and how it might relate to the plot and characters
make inferences about character motivations and relationships
note what conflicts arise and how they are resolved

a theme may be indicated through the lessons learned by the characters in a particular setting. as you read “the war of the wall” keep these tips in mind in order to identify the story’s themes!
